Mohali: The municipal corporation would soon introduce a geographic information system (GIS) based cellphone application which would help digitize the civic facilities. A special card carrying a Unique Identification Number or UIN would be allotted to individuals and senior citizens would be the first to get these once the project gets operational.

A survey has started and soon, data related to property and other needs would be integrated, analysed, shared and will be displayed in the smartphone application. GIS applications include tools which allow users to create interactive queries, analyse spatial information, edit data in maps and obtain results of all these operations. In-charge for this initiative would be MC commissioner Uma Shankar Gupta.

With the unique identity number (UIN), residents would be able to pay water and sewerage bills and assess property tax after assessment using the mobile application itself. The application which is yet to be named would be available on Android and iOS devices, and would likely benefit around 55,000 households. Also, this would include general information and complaint system as well. Through the application, residents can forward a request for alternation in basic details like owner's name, addresses, cellphone number, among others. These changes would reflect once authorized by a competent authority.

An SMS system would also be put in place through which users would be informed of their taxes and bills due for payment.
